There aren't many places around like Finch's anymore. Sure, there are places with a diner motif, but they all just popped up in the last decade. Finch's, on the other hand, is the real deal. Located within walking distance to most downtown Raleigh government offices, this since-1945 eatery has a loyal clientele of business folks and families who want a real Southern breakfast or lunch. The griddle fires up at 6AM (7AM on Sundays), when the first patrons begin to arrive for county ham and eggs, corned beef hash, pecan waffles, raspberry pancakes with warm maple syrup and a diner favorite, creamed chip beef. At lunchtime, it's all about the daily special that's hard to beat price-wise, never topping $6. Favorites are the baked chicken with rice and gravy, pot roast with carrots and potatoes, and meatloaf. Specials are served with two sides, such as fried okra and stewed apples, and of course, bottomless iced tea. Sandwiches, burgers, fried seafood and salads round out the menu. If you feel you just can't escape the office, but still need a good meal, bring your laptop -- there's free Wi-Fi here.
